Indian boxers Amit Panghal and Nitu Ghanghas won their semifinal battles in the Commonwealth Games 2022 in Birmingham on Saturday. Panghal defeated Zambia’s Patrick Chinyemba in Men’s Over 48kg-51kg to enter the final while Nitu won against Canada’s Priyanka Dhillon to enter the women’s 45kg-48kg (Minimumweight) final.
